If you've often thought Disney is out of the ballpark when it comes to
your budget, there may be some ways to cut just enough corners to make
it happen this year. For Melanie Swoap, this is where her love of Disney
all started. She worked there, and now works to help others afford the
magic.



"A lot of people think it's out of the realm to go to Disney and it's not," says Swoap.



One way Swoap helps people cut costs through her company Blue Sky
Journeys is by dropping the park hopper Pass if you're going to be there
more than a few days. Most people could jsut as easily designate each
day at one park and pocket the money.



"When you're looking at a 5-day ticket, it's usually around $239 total.
Not per day, but total, to add that park hopper," says Swoap. "So that's
a significant savings to most people because you can spend that on
merchandise or food or something else."



Swoap, whose company is a Disney designated travel agency, also knows
the cheapest times to visit and when the park is running specials.
January, February, August are the months you'll often get deep discounts
on rooms, even food.



"Historically we've had the luxury of the free dining offer," says
Swoap. "For families to know they can go book their resort book their
tickets and eat for free is wonderful."



If you don't time it right to take advantage of the free dining
promotion, there are other ways to save on food. Disney does allow you
to bring in soft coolers. Load it up with sandwiches, snacks and
refillable water bottles. If you plan to eat on property, the Disney
dining plans can save you 10%-30% too. It's worth your money to pick up a
Disney Savings Book. Full of money-saving tips. One thing we learned:
bring your own stroller instead of paying dollars a day to rent one from
Disney that doesn't recline and has very little storage. Also, shop for
souvenirs off property. The nearest Walmart there has a huge Disney
section for half the cost.Disney
